Chicago’s vibrant arts scene is set to receive a significant boost with the announcement of the Performing Arts and Media Fund Foundation (PMAFF) grant program, offering up to $250,000 for local arts organizations. This initiative aims to empower these institutions to develop and present bold, innovative performance works, fostering creativity and cultural enrichment across the city.

Key Highlights:

  • PMAFF is offering substantial funding of up to $250,000.
  • The grant is specifically targeted at Chicago-based arts organizations.
  • Funds are designated for the creation of new, bold performance works.
  • The program seeks to foster innovation and artistic excellence.

PMAFF Grant: Fueling Chicago’s Performing Arts Landscape

The Performing Arts and Media Fund Foundation (PMAFF) has unveiled a significant funding opportunity designed to invigorate Chicago’s dynamic performing arts sector. With a maximum grant award of $250,000, this program represents a major investment in the city’s cultural infrastructure. The grant’s primary objective is to support arts organizations in their endeavor to create and premiere ambitious new performance works. This funding is crucial for nurturing artistic experimentation, enabling established and emerging groups to push creative boundaries, and presenting audiences with fresh, compelling theatrical, dance, music, and multidisciplinary performances.

Eligibility and Application Process

While the full details of the application process are forthcoming, it is understood that eligible organizations must be based within the city of Chicago and demonstrate a clear commitment to the performing arts. PMAFF is looking for proposals that showcase originality, artistic merit, and a clear vision for the proposed work. The grant is not intended for general operating support but rather for specific new projects, emphasizing the creation and presentation phases. Interested organizations should prepare to submit detailed project proposals, including budgets, artistic statements, and evidence of organizational capacity.
